In today’s tech-driven world, software applications play an integral role in our daily lives. From mobile apps to web platforms, every click, scroll, and interaction shapes how users perceive a product. For businesses, delivering an exceptional user experience (UX) isn’t just a luxury; it’s a necessity. But what ensures that these digital experiences are smooth, intuitive, and glitch-free? The answer lies in software testing. For those intrigued by the meticulous process of software quality assurance, a Software Testing Course in Chennai can provide you with the skills needed to become an expert in the field.

Bridging the Gap Between Users and Technology

Imagine downloading an app to book a movie ticket, but it crashes midway or takes forever to load. Frustrating, isn’t it? These issues highlight the importance of software testing in creating a seamless user experience. Whether it’s identifying bugs, ensuring smooth navigation, or verifying compatibility across devices, software testing acts as a safety net, ensuring users face minimal disruptions. With hands-on training, you’ll learn the nuances of crafting error-free applications that resonate with users.

Enhancing User Interface and Navigation

The first impression users have of an application often comes from its design and functionality. An attractive user interface (UI) paired with intuitive navigation creates a positive experience. Software testing ensures that every feature, from clickable buttons to dropdown menus, works flawlessly.

UI testing plays a crucial role in evaluating the layout, design elements, and responsiveness of the application. This not only helps developers spot inconsistencies. If you’re passionate about design and want to explore this aspect further, enrolling in a UI UX Designer Course in Chennai is a great way to dive deeper into creating user-centric designs.

Building Trust Through Reliability

Trust is a cornerstone of user experience. Users expect applications to perform reliably without glitches or security vulnerabilities. A single error can tarnish the credibility of an application and drive users away. Through comprehensive software testing, developers can detect and rectify potential issues before they reach end-users.

For instance, load testing ensures an application can handle multiple users simultaneously, while security testing safeguards sensitive user data. These steps reassure users that the application is trustworthy and secure.

Personalizing the User Journey

Software testing also plays a significant role in creating personalized experiences. By testing features like user preferences, recommendations, and customized settings, testers ensure that applications cater to individual user needs. Personalization makes users feel valued, leading to higher engagement and satisfaction levels.

For those looking to contribute to such innovations, a UI UX Course in Bangalore provides a comprehensive understanding of designing tailored experiences that enhance user satisfaction.

Improving Performance and Speed

One of the most common user grievances is slow application performance. A lagging app or website can frustrate users and lead to abandonment. Software testing focuses on optimizing performance by identifying bottlenecks and ensuring swift response times.

Performance testing tools simulate real-world scenarios, such as heavy user traffic or limited bandwidth, to evaluate how the application performs under pressure. This process guarantees that users enjoy a fast and responsive experience, regardless of external factors.

Ensuring Accessibility for All Users

Inclusion is a vital aspect of modern software development. Software testing ensures that applications are accessible to everyone, including individuals with disabilities. Features like voice commands, screen readers, and keyboard navigation are thoroughly tested to meet accessibility standards.

By prioritizing inclusivity, companies not only expand their user base but also establish themselves as socially responsible brands.

Opportunities in the World of Software Testing

As the demand for flawless software grows, so does the need for skilled testers. Software testing is no longer limited to debugging; it has evolved into a strategic process that directly impacts user satisfaction.

If you’re considering a career in this field, enrolling in a Software Testing Course in Bangalore can equip you with the necessary skills to excel. Courses like these cover manual testing, automation tools, and advanced testing methodologies, ensuring you’re industry-ready.